During the next 5 days, dry weather will prevail from California to the central and southern High Plains, while only light showers will dot the Southeast. In contrast, drought-easing rainfall will develop in the Northeast, while occasional rain and snow showers will affect the remainder of the northern U.S. Surges of progressively colder air will overspread the Northwest and most areas from the Rockies eastward, while warmth will linger across California and the Southwest. During the weekend and early next week, temperatures will plunge below 20° across northern sections of the Rockies and Plains, while freezes should occur as far south as the northern panhandle of Texas and in much of the Midwest.
